About Quincy Clerk
The Quincy Clerk, located in Quincy, Massachusetts, is the official keeper of public records for Norfolk County. The Clerk's office ensures that public records are retained, archived, and made accessible to the public in accordance with all laws and regulations. Clerks also support the elections process and provide a variety of transactional services. The Clerk's duties are established and regulated through a combination of Massachusetts state statutes, local ordinances and charters, and other regulations.
- Vital records including birth, death, and marriage certificates held by Quincy Clerk
- Voter registration, election schedules, and polling place information
- Property deeds, liens, and recorded land documents
- Marriage license applications and local business filings
